AI Technical Summary

Technical Problem

In HVAC systems, interference can easily occur during the installation of electrical control boards, leading to greater installation difficulty and lower assembly efficiency.

Method used

An outdoor unit structure was designed, including a boss and an end plate. The electronic control board is mounted on the boss, which protrudes from the end plate body along a first direction, increasing the distance between the electronic control board and the mounting component, reducing interference, and realizing electrical connection through the main control board, thus simplifying the assembly process.

Benefits of technology

The installation difficulty of the control board has been reduced, the assembly efficiency has been improved, the space occupied by the control board in the indoor unit has been reduced, the indoor unit is smaller in size, and the installation process is stable.

[0045] In related technologies, HVAC systems include air conditioners, heat pumps, pool machines, and water heaters. An HVAC system comprises multiple indoor units, each equipped with a corresponding electrical control board to control its operation. These control boards require different mounting structures to secure them relative to the outdoor unit's casing. Typically, the mounting structures are individually fixed to the outdoor unit's casing. During the installation of the control boards, one board and its corresponding mounting structure must be fixed first, followed by the installation of another board and its corresponding structure. The installation of the preceding control board may affect the installation process of the subsequent one, thus increasing the difficulty of installation.

[0046] The outdoor unit of this application is equipped with a first electronic control board 300 and a second electronic control board 500. The first electronic control board 300 and the second electronic control board 500 are electrically connected to the main control board 700 to control different indoor units respectively. The first electronic control board 300 is mounted on the end plate 200, and the second electronic control board 500 is mounted on the mounting component 400. The mounting component 400 is mounted on the side of the end plate 200 opposite to the first electronic control board 300. The first electronic control board 300 and the second electronic control board 500 can be assembled outside the housing 100, and then the end plate 200 is installed on the housing 100 to realize the installation of the first electronic control board 300 and the second electronic control board 500. The assembly method is simple, and the assembly process is not limited by the internal space of the housing 100.

[0057] In one embodiment, please refer to Figure 3The boss 210 and the mounting member 400 form a cavity 210a. The cavity 210a is located on one side of the mounting member 400 along a first direction. The boss 210 has a first mounting hole 210b communicating with the cavity 210a. The first electronic control board 300 includes a first mounting hook 310, which can pass through the first mounting hole 210b to extend into the interior of the cavity 210a. The first mounting hook 310 is engaged with the edge of the first mounting hole 210b. The first electronic control board 300 and the boss 210 are connected by the first mounting hook 310 and the first mounting hole 210b, which enables the first electronic control board 300 to be quickly positioned relative to the end plate 200, increasing assembly efficiency. Furthermore, the cavity 210a can avoid the first mounting hook 310, increasing the engagement depth between the first mounting hook 310 and the first mounting hole 210b. Furthermore, the boss 210 and the first electronic control board 300 can be fixedly connected by screws to increase the connection strength between the first electronic control board 300 and the end plate 200. The cavity 210a can avoid the screws and reduce interference between the screws and the mounting part 400.

[0063] In one embodiment, please refer to Figure 1 The contour line connecting the transition member 212 and the carrier member 211 is the first contour line 212a, and the contour line connecting the transition member 212 and the end plate body 220 is the second contour line 212b. Projected along the thickness direction of the end plate 200, the projection area of ​​the first contour line 212a is located within the projection area of ​​the second contour line 212b. It can be understood that the projection area of ​​the first contour line 212a represents the size of the opening 220e of the cavity 210a facing the carrier member 211, and the projection area of ​​the second contour line 212b represents the size of the opening 220e of the cavity 210a facing the mounting member 400. In the first direction, the size of the opening 220e of the cavity 210a gradually decreases, resulting in a larger connection area between the transition member 212 and the end plate body 220 to provide greater connection strength. The boss 210 is roughly truncated pyramidal in shape, and the overall rigidity of the boss 210 is high. During the operation of the outdoor unit, the amplitude of vibration generated by the boss 210 is small, thereby making the first electrical control board 300 installed on the boss 210 more stable.

[0068] In one embodiment, please refer to Figure 3 The second mounting hole 220a includes a guide hole 220b and a receiving hole 220c that are interconnected. The guide hole 220b is located above the receiving hole 220c. The opening 220e of the guide hole 220b gradually decreases in size from top to bottom. The second mounting hook 400a engages with the edge of the receiving hole 220c. During the installation of the mounting component 400 onto the end plate body 220, the second mounting hook 400a can extend from the guide hole 220b into the second mounting hole 220a, and then move downwards to move into the receiving hole 220c. The larger opening 220e of the guide hole 220b reduces the assembly accuracy of the second mounting hook 400a when installing it into the second mounting hole 220a, increases the installation speed of the end plate 200 of the mounting component 400, and improves assembly efficiency.

[0075] In one embodiment, please refer to Figure 3 The end plate body 220 has a flange 220f extending along a first direction. The flange 220f is located above the first electronic control board 300 and is projected in the vertical direction. The projection area of ​​the boss 210 and the projection area of ​​the first electronic control board 300 are located within the projection area of ​​the flange 220f. For example, the flange 220f is formed at the top of the end plate body 220.

[0076] In the embodiment of this application, the end plate body 220 has a flange 220f extending along a first direction. The flange 220f can play a certain role in blocking water from the first electronic control board 300, reducing the possibility of the first electronic control board 300 being short-circuited by external condensation or rainwater. Furthermore, in the event of debris falling above the first electronic control board 300, the flange 220f can block the debris, reducing the possibility of the first electronic control board 300 being damaged by external debris.
